Getting to the seashore is easy, 27 minutes by comfortable train from the central station, and then just 10 minutes on foot, and you are already at the sea, that is, you get to the sea even faster than if you go to Jurmala. The beach is wide and beautiful, it is very pleasant to walk along it. 500 meters to the right of the main beach begins a nudist beach, now recognized as one of the best in the world. For this reason, there is a flow of pedestrians and tourists there. Alas, the nudist beach is hardly worth visiting for non-nudists. There is nothing in it that deserves attention. There are not even benches on the shore to sit on. Moreover, it is impossible to have a snack or drink anything. However, a walk along the sea is always pleasant.
